The Hidden Foundation of the Modern Cottage Garden

As we navigate the landscaping trends of 2026, the romantic, overflowing aesthetic of the English cottage garden remains a top choice for homeowners seeking to boost curb appeal and support local pollinators. However, the modern approach to cottage garden design has shifted dramatically toward ecological resilience and regenerative soil practices. When designing vibrant borders featuring Mediterranean staples like lavender (Lavandula angustifolia) and prairie natives like purple coneflower (Echinacea purpurea), the secret to long-term success lies beneath the surface. While most gardeners focus on plant spacing and sunlight, the most critical step in establishing these drought-tolerant perennials is addressing soil compaction through targeted core aeration techniques.

Historically, core aeration has been viewed strictly as a lawn care practice. Yet, in 2026, advanced landscaping methodologies recognize that the transition zones between turfgrass and garden beds—and the beds themselves—suffer from severe soil compaction. This compaction is often caused by years of foot traffic, heavy mower wheels edging the lawn, and natural soil settling. For deep-rooted perennials and moisture-sensitive shrubs, compacted soil is a silent killer. By adapting core aeration principles for garden bed preparation, you can create the loose, well-draining, and oxygen-rich environment that lavender and coneflowers require to thrive.

Bridging Lawn Care and Garden Design: The Core Aeration Connection

When expanding a lawn edge to create a new cottage garden border, you are typically working with some of the most compacted soil on your property. The University of Minnesota Extension notes that soil compaction reduces pore space, severely limiting water infiltration and root penetration. In a traditional lawn setting, a gas-powered core aerator pulls physical plugs of soil to the surface, relieving this pressure. In a garden bed setting, heavy machinery is impractical and destructive to soil structure. Therefore, we adapt the principle of core aeration using manual and liquid methods to achieve the same biological and physical benefits without destroying the delicate soil food web.

The Perils of Compacted Soil for Mediterranean and Prairie Natives

Understanding the root dynamics of your chosen plants is essential. Lavender is notoriously susceptible to root rot. It demands sharp drainage and highly aerated soil. If planted in heavy, compacted clay that holds water, lavender will quickly succumb to fungal pathogens, regardless of how much sunlight it receives. Conversely, purple coneflower relies on a deep, extensive taproot to survive the intense summer droughts that have become increasingly common in recent years. According to the NC State Extension Plant Database, Echinacea purpurea requires well-drained soils to establish its deep root system, which can extend several feet underground in search of moisture. If a hardpan layer of compacted soil exists just a few inches below the surface, the taproot will deflect, stunt, or rot, leaving the plant vulnerable to heat stress.

Step-by-Step Soil Aeration for Cottage Garden Borders

To prepare your border for a lush mix of lavender and coneflowers, follow this modern, no-till aeration protocol designed to preserve soil microbiology while eliminating compaction.

Step 1: The Compaction Assessment

Before breaking ground, perform a simple screwdriver test. Push a standard 6-inch screwdriver into the soil. If you cannot push it in to the handle with moderate body weight, your soil is critically compacted and requires immediate aeration before planting.

Step 2: Manual Core Extraction and Broadforking

Avoid using rototillers. Tilling destroys soil aggregates, brings dormant weed seeds to the surface, and severs beneficial mycorrhizal fungal networks. Instead, use a manual broadfork or a stand-on manual core aerator.

  • Broadforking: Insert the tines of a broadfork into the soil and gently rock the handles back toward you. This fractures the compacted layers deep underground, creating massive vertical channels for air and water without turning the soil over.
  • Manual Coring: For tighter border spaces near existing lawn edges, use a step-on manual core aerator to pull actual 3-inch plugs of soil. Leave these plugs on the surface to break down naturally over the next few weeks, returning beneficial microbes to the topsoil.

Step 3: Filling the Voids (Topdressing)

Once the soil is fractured and cores are removed, you must keep those channels open. Sweep a mixture of coarse horticultural sand and high-quality screened compost into the aeration holes. This mimics the topdressing process used on premium golf courses, ensuring that the newly created pore spaces remain permanently aerated and well-draining—exactly what the NC State Extension Lavender Guide recommends for optimal Lavandula health.

Planting Strategy: Lavender and Coneflower Pairings

Once your soil is properly aerated and amended, you can begin planting. The visual contrast between the silvery, fine-textured foliage of lavender and the coarse, dark green leaves of the coneflower creates a stunning cottage garden aesthetic. Furthermore, their staggered blooming times ensure a continuous nectar source for pollinators from early summer through the first autumn frost.

2026 Soil & Aeration Requirements: Lavender vs. Coneflower
Feature Lavender (Lavandula angustifolia) Coneflower (Echinacea purpurea)
Soil Drainage Excellent; requires sharp drainage Good; tolerates average drainage
Aeration Depth Needed Top 12 inches (fibrous root zone) Top 18-24 inches (deep taproot zone)
Soil pH Preference 6.5 to 7.5 (slightly alkaline) 6.0 to 7.0 (slightly acidic to neutral)
Compaction Tolerance None (highly susceptible to rot) Low (taproot deflection occurs)
Post-Aeration Amendment Coarse sand, gravel, minimal compost Rich organic compost, loam

Spacing and Placement

Plant lavender in the front or middle of the border where it will receive maximum sun exposure and heat reflection from hardscaping elements. Space plants 18 to 24 inches apart to ensure adequate airflow, which prevents foliar diseases. Place coneflowers toward the back or center of the bed, spacing them 12 to 18 inches apart. Because coneflowers are native to prairies, they are highly competitive and will readily fill in the gaps between the slower-growing lavender shrubs.

Maintaining the Borders Through the Seasons

Aeration is not a one-time event; it is an ongoing component of soil management. To maintain the structural integrity of your cottage garden borders in 2026 and beyond, implement the following maintenance routines:

  • Annual Liquid Aeration: Every early spring, apply a liquid soil aerator (containing humic and fulvic acids) to the borders. This encourages earthworm activity and keeps soil particles from binding back together into hardpan layers.
  • Mulching with Gravel: While shredded hardwood mulch is common, it retains too much moisture for lavender. Instead, use a 1-inch layer of crushed pea gravel or decomposed granite around the base of the lavender. This suppresses weeds, reflects heat, and allows rain to penetrate instantly without compacting the soil surface.
  • Establish Dedicated Pathways: The primary cause of soil re-compaction in garden beds is foot traffic. Install stepping stones or permeable paver pathways along your borders to ensure you never have to step directly onto the planting soil to perform weeding or deadheading.
